HPC环境配置与集群性能优化 在当今科技发展的浪潮中,高性能计算(HPC)已经成为科学研究和工程领域中不可或缺的一部分。为了充分发挥HPC的优势,必须对HPC环境进行有效的配置和集群性能进行优化。 首先,HPC环境配置的关键在于选择合适的硬件设备。高性能处理器、大容量内存、快速存储设备以及高性能网络是构建高效HPC环境的基础。另外,合理的布局和散热设计也是不可忽视的因素。 其次,软件环境的配置同样至关重要。在HPC环境中,操作系统、编译器、库文件等软件的选择和配置将直接影响到计算性能。因此,对于HPC环境中的软件配置,必须进行全面的考量和优化。 针对HPC集群性能优化,首先需对计算负载进行合理的分配和调度。通过合理的任务分配和调度策略,可以充分利用集群中各节点的计算资源,提高整体的计算效率。 其次,对于数据的管理与存储也是影响HPC集群性能的关键因素。通过合理的数据存储策略,可以降低数据访问的延迟,提高数据IO的效率,从而加快计算任务的执行速度。 此外,网络通信环境也是影响HPC集群性能的重要因素。通过对网络拓扑结构的合理设计和网络设备的优化配置,可以降低节点之间的通信延迟,提高数据传输的效率。 在HPC集群性能优化过程中,还需要关注到并行计算和多线程优化。通过合理的并行计算模型和多线程优化策略,可以充分发挥多核处理器和多线程技术的优势,提高计算任务的并行性和整体性能。 总的来说,HPC环境配置与集群性能优化是一个复杂而又关键的工作。只有在硬件设备、软件环境、任务调度、数据IO、网络通信以及并行计算等方方面面都进行了全面的优化,才能够充分发挥HPC的计算能力,为科学研究和工程应用提供更强大的支持。 |
说点什么...